Thanks for your e-mail.? Your rig interface choice is not relevant for WSJT-X to transfer the QSO data.? Your port in WSJT-X and AC Log must have the same port settings.? Please make sure both AC Log and WSJT-X are set to the same port as detailed here:



When set correctly, in AC Log, after you click Listen for WSJT-X, the timer displaying the elapsed seconds will flash green and reset every few seconds.? If that is not happening, you will need to correct your settings.

I'm not familiar with OneDrive, but I am doing this with Dropbox without using the networking feature.

I have in the past had two computers, each using separate transceivers, accessing the same log file at the same time during contests (using multi-transmitter classes), and using N3FJP contest?software.? Both computers are on the same network.

I need to observe this again to?verify how it works, but I seem to remember that when both computers are logging at the same time, computer?A might remain preloaded with a contact after telling it to log, appearing not to be responding to the logging command.? It's waiting for computer B to log first.? After computer?B logs, it is followed by computer A logging without the op doing anything more, and both contacts appear in the log.? So, it appears that when using two computers in this way, they log in an orderly fashion.? I don't know if this is an N3FJP feature, how Windows works, or something else.

It's a good idea to back up your log before you test this.? If you create a test log on each computer, and log them, be sure that they are deleted from your log before you upload to LoTW or other similar loggers.

The easy way in N3FJP ACL to submit your log for 13 Colonies

 

1. Use Control-Click (on Windows) to select your 13C QSOs in ACL. They do not have to be contiguous in your log. If you have a clean sweep including WM3PEN and the UK and France stations, that's 16 in all.
2. File > Export ADIF > Selected Records and put the file somewhere convenient.
3. Go to . Enter the information in Step 1.
4. In Step 2, Choose the ADIF file you just created.
5. In Step 3, click Generate Log Form.
6. Click the link "Click Here to Download Your Completed PDF Log Form".
7. Print the PDF file and mail it with your check and your return address label to the specified address.

73 Chuck K4RGN??

Re: ACL not syncing to eLog: QRZ XML

 

Hi Tony,

Thanks for your e-mail.? I'm sorry that you ran into trouble.? I'm pretty sure this is a QRZ problem, likely caused by the slash in your call sign.? AC Log only sends your API Access Key.? It doesn't send your call sign, which is returned by the QRZ server.? Here is the relevant code section and all the data returned from the request:

Inline image


START_DATE=1992-07-06&DXCC_COUNT=275&CONFIRMED=17372&RESULT=OK&BOOKID=120743&END_DATE=2042-10-02&CALLSIGN=N3FJP&BOOK_NAME=N3FJP Logbook&COUNT=80611&OWNER=N3FJP&ACTION=STATUS

All the returned values are stored with your account on QRZ as identified by your API key.

Additionally, the QRZ server in your case reported an internal error.

"STATUS=FAIL&REASON=QRZ Internal Error: Unable to add QSO to database.&EXTENDED=add_qso: book callsign mismatch"
